"More than INTENSE"

What I like about this game is the SPEED. It is intense, sort of like old school F-Zero. Speeds becoming almost blinding, a lot of streaks along the edges show incredible speed. But, nevertheless, here's the breakdown.

GAMEPLAY - 10

The controls are almost perfect... I couldn't imagine any improvements in this area. The actual button pressing is kept super easy, only 4 buttons can get you through this game. This means it delivers an intense arcade-style racing game. I love Gran Turismo, but this is far from it. This game reminds me of a kid at the arcade playing all those crazy racing games.

SOUND - 10

The car sounds are superb, crashes, throttle, blah blah. The only thing holding it back is the narrator. He's kinda cheesy and is extremely repetitive. But after a while you tend to ignore him. If he gets to you, then just simply turn down his commentary. Most tracks are emo-punk so if you like that, then HURRAY! I do like a lot of punk, but not the poppy crap where the singer whines about ex-girlfriends and crap. Thank God there is a bit of diversity (Pennywise and others.)

CARS - 8

Given that this a arcade style racing game, the cars are a bit bland. How many versions of a "coupe" are there? This gets kinda annoying, but there are really cool unlockables like UPS trucks and Fire Trucks! This brings the value back up. Also, there are only two stats for cars, speed and weight. I laughed when I saw it, but after playing the game, these are probably only the two stats cars really need.

GRAPHICS - 9

Graphics are really cool. The "speed" aspect is great with streaks at high speeds. It really makes this game INTENSE. Also, there are no hiccups in the frame-rate department. After a week of solid playing, I haven't noticed any slow downs at all. Awesome coding, congrats to EA. Lighting effects are so-so, but who really cares, or notices when you're driving at incredible speeds? One thing for sure is good is the VANISHING POINT. On an open road, you can see well enough in the distance to swerve your car into another lane if traffic is coming. This aspect is extremely important.

RUBBERBAND EFFECT - 9

Everybody seems to hate this concept, but this racing game would suck otherwise. Use the rubberband effect to your advantage. Don't waste precious boost on the open road, wait til they catch up and ram the crap out of them. It's really not bad and adds intensity to the game.

Anybody who loves racing games should buy this. Hardcore Gran Turismo people should rent this first before throwing down $50. I can't speak for everyone, but this game, I believe, will be top 10 this year in many gamer magazines. As far as I'm concerned, it's a must-buy. Hope this review helps.
